At the Institute of Data Science in Jena, we are working on making the data backbone a reality for all DLR application areas (aeronautics, space, energy, transport, security). To this end, we develop and research methods in interdisciplinary work focussing on applications such as sustainable and circular processes, resilient supply chains, data-driven value chains or robust decision support. The methods developed in this way are applied in cooperation with other DLR institutes and external partners, either as part of joint projects or as part of technology transfer activities.

In the "Information Extraction and Interoperability" working group, we research and develop innovative and practical solutions for digitisation and mitigating incompatibility in communication between different areas.
This position involves the development of methods and tools for information extraction, with a focus on 3D CAD data. Furthermore, this position deals with the computer-interpretable modelling of machine capabilities and the resulting matching of components with machines suitable for their manufacture.
